Why Construction & Engineering Oracle Testing Is Different

Construction and engineering Oracle ERP testing runs against project lifecycles that span years, revenue recognition models that change per contract (percentage-of-completion vs completed-contract vs ASC 606 input/output methods), subcontractor networks that bring their own compliance risk, equipment fleets that move across projects and lien-waiver discipline that protects payment rights.

Construction & Engineering Oracle Testing Challenges

Percentage-of-Completion / ASC 606

Revenue recognition under PoC, input-method (cost-to-cost) or output-method (units delivered) requires accurate cost and progress tracking.

Subcontractor Compliance

Insurance, bonding, licenses, COI, OSHA certifications must be current. Lapses create liability and compliance exposure.

Change-Order Discipline

Approved, pending and disputed change orders affect contract value, schedule and revenue. Defects cascade through every billing cycle.

Lien Waiver Workflow

Conditional/unconditional, progress/final lien waivers must collect with each payment to protect lien rights. Missing waivers risk mechanic's lien.

Equipment Cost Allocation

Owned and rented equipment move across projects with allocation, depreciation and utilisation reporting requirements.

Retainage & Progress Billing

AIA G702/G703 progress billing with retainage hold and release tracking must reconcile across project, contract and customer.

REGULATORY ALIGNMENT

Compliance & Regulatory Coverage

ASC 606 / IFRS 15 Revenue Recognition

Performance obligation, transaction price allocation and revenue timing validated per contract type — supporting external audit and quarterly reporting.

OSHA / Safety Compliance

Subcontractor OSHA 10/30 certification tracking, safety incident reporting and safety meeting records validated through HCM and Procurement.

State Mechanic's Lien Law

Conditional and unconditional lien waiver collection workflows validated per state statutory timing requirements.

Davis-Bacon / Prevailing Wage

Certified payroll generation, wage classification and fringe benefit calculation validated for federally-funded projects.
